GUMBO


Meaning of GUMBO in English

/gum"boh/ , n. , pl. gumbos , adj.

n.

1. a stew or thick soup, usually made with chicken or seafood, greens, and okra or sometimes filé as a thickener.

2. okra.

3. soil that becomes sticky and nonporous when wet.

adj.

4. of, pertaining to, or like gumbo.

[ 1795-1805, Amer.; gombo, gumbo ochinggombo, Luba chinggombo okra ]
